Understanding the Benefits of Electric Cars
Electric cars, or EVs, have become increasingly popular as consumers grow more environmentally conscious and seek cost-effective alternatives to traditional gasoline vehicles. EVs offer several benefits, including reduced greenhouse gas emissions, decreased noise pollution, and lower running costs. They also contribute to improved air quality, making urban areas healthier places to live in.
Environmental Impact
One of the most compelling reasons to choose an electric car is its reduced environmental impact. Traditional vehicles run on fossil fuels, which release carbon dioxide and other pollutants into the atmosphere. In contrast, EVs produce zero tailpipe emissions, significantly lowering their carbon footprint.
Evaluating the Cost of Ownership
The cost of owning an electric vehicle is generally lower than that of a gas-powered car over the life of the vehicle. While the upfront cost of EVs can be higher, several factors help offset this initial price. For instance, the cost of electricity as a fuel is substantially lower than gasoline. Additionally, electric cars have fewer moving parts than traditional vehicles, which means lower maintenance expenses since there's no need for oil changes, transmission repairs, or exhaust system replacements.
Financial Incentives
Governments worldwide are encouraging the transition to electric vehicles by offering various financial incentives, which further reduce the overall cost of ownership. In the United States, for example, buyers of new EVs can benefit from federal tax credits of up to $7,500, depending on the make and model of the vehicle. Many states and municipalities also offer additional rebates, tax incentives, and perks, such as access to carpool lanes.
Infrastructure and Range Considerations
As electric cars grow in popularity, the infrastructure supporting them has expanded rapidly. Charging stations are becoming more commonplace, with many available at convenient locations such as shopping centers, parking garages, and highway rest stops.
Understanding EV Range
Range anxiety is a common concern among potential EV buyers, but advancements in battery technology have led to significant increases in the distance an electric car can travel on a single charge. Many modern EVs can now travel over 200 miles per charge, with some high-end models surpassing 300 miles. It's crucial to assess your daily travel needs when choosing an electric car to ensure the vehicle's range comfortably fits your lifestyle. Resources like the U.S. Department of Energy's Fuel Economy website offer valuable insights into the range capabilities of various EV models.
